Step by Step Method
Step 1
Combine all the marinade ingredients in a large bowl, then add the chicken pieces and mix well to make sure all the pieces are covered and refrigerate for at least two hours, or overnight if possible.
Step 2
Place the chicken pieces in a baking dish, or a preheated camp oven, and bake at 200ºC, until cooked.
Step 3
You could also barbecue the chicken, especially if using smaller cuts, such as drumettes or ribs.
Step 4
Serve with steamed vegetables and rice.
Step 5
TIP - instead of marinating the chicken in a bowl or container, use a large zip-lock plastic bag for all the marinade ingredients and the chicken. Zip the bag closed, squish the chicken around to coat thoroughly and leave in the fridge. It will take up a lot less room in your camp fridge.
